diff options
author | Brian Paul <[email protected]> | 2018-01-17 12:54:04 -0700 |
---|---|---|
committer | Brian Paul <[email protected]> | 2018-01-24 10:12:49 -0700 |
commit | cb7ef0df00e19d87d4d2dd95aff2318df2e17dc3 (patch) | |
tree | eadea518a10248af631f7d16694fa0ff01ee2193 /src/mesa/vbo/vbo_context.h | |
parent | 8b3cb7c651eeed66e4c6cc719918c4dd792cf9e1 (diff) |
vbo: replace assert(0) with unreachable()
Reviewed-by: Roland Scheidegger <[email protected]>
Diffstat (limited to 'src/mesa/vbo/vbo_context.h')
-rw-r--r-- | src/mesa/vbo/vbo_context.h |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/mesa/vbo/vbo_context.h b/src/mesa/vbo/vbo_context.h index 04079b7d329..cd1cbd9641b 100644 --- a/src/mesa/vbo/vbo_context.h +++ b/src/mesa/vbo/vbo_context.h @@ -154,7 +154,7 @@ vbo_draw_method(struct vbo_context *vbo, gl_draw_method method) ctx->Array._DrawArrays = vbo->save.inputs; break; default: - assert(0); + unreachable("Bad VBO drawing method"); } ctx->NewDriverState |= ctx->DriverFlags.NewArray; @@ -178,7 +178,7 @@ vbo_attrtype_to_integer_flag(GLenum format) case GL_UNSIGNED_INT64_ARB: return GL_TRUE; default: - assert(0); + unreachable("Bad vertex attribute type"); return GL_FALSE; } } @@ -195,7 +195,7 @@ vbo_attrtype_to_double_flag(GLenum format) case GL_DOUBLE: return GL_TRUE; default: - assert(0); + unreachable("Bad vertex attribute type"); return GL_FALSE; } } @@ -218,7 +218,7 @@ vbo_get_default_vals_as_union(GLenum format) case GL_UNSIGNED_INT: return (fi_type *)default_int; default: - assert(0); + unreachable("Bad vertex format"); return NULL; } } |